Recent analysis has revealed that a malware known as Chaos is now targeting 64-bit Linux servers, primarily associated with groups linked to China. Researchers found that these attackers are employing a two-pronged strategy: one that acts quickly and another that allows for longer dwell times within compromised systems. This dual approach not only increases the chances of successful infiltration but also makes it harder for organizations to detect and respond to the attacks. Given the prevalence of Linux servers in various industries, this development poses a significant risk to a wide range of businesses, potentially leading to data breaches and service disruptions. Residential proxies undermine IP reputation systems, researchers warn

SCM feed for Latest

A recent study by GreyNoise has revealed that a significant portion of malicious online activity, about 39%, comes from home networks, likely linked to residential proxy services. These proxies allow users to mask their true IP addresses, making it harder for security systems to identify and block malicious traffic. This trend poses a challenge for companies trying to maintain accurate IP reputation systems, as the line between legitimate and malicious traffic blurs. As residential proxies become more common, organizations may find it increasingly difficult to protect themselves from various cyber threats.
